Output 2143d88977a2886bd172f62d7c7918ee3edcdc2eb349a310f1929d4067c11395:0

value
846853323818
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e0bdae8bfc71ff75e387e2b44ef68ccfe4c7964 OP_EQUALVERIFY OP_CHECKSIG
address
16f56bsbA4QPCDMW7xHnquyvZcFuNNHBcr
transaction
2143d88977a2886bd172f62d7c7918ee3edcdc2eb349a310f1929d4067c11395
spent
true